Choose your music and defeat Skibidi Toilet in this exciting music game
Choose your music and defeat Skibidi Toilet in this exciting music game.
Upgrade your special performance to gain more score!
Enjoy the cool song!
Choose your music and defeat Skibidi Toilet in this exciting music game